Stock and commodity perpetual futures trading volume on crypto exchanges soared to $778 billion in August, accounting for about 23.5% of total perpetual futures trading volume. This figure shows a sharp rise compared to the previous share of only 0.5%, highlighting that crypto platforms are rapidly breaking out of the category of digital assets such as Bitcoin and expanding into traditional market-related transactions. This sharp rise in trading volume reflects the market's growing preference for using cryptographic infrastructure to trade stocks and commodities-related assets around the clock. This huge trading volume indicates that crypto exchanges are gradually becoming speculative trading places in traditional markets, and may blur the boundaries between traditional finance and digital assets.
